Dental Support Services is of the hottest associate degree programs in the United States, coming in as the #19 most popular major in the country. So, there are lots of possibilities to explore when you're trying to determine where you want to get your degree.

For its 2022 ranking, College Factual looked at 15 schools in the New England Region to determine which ones were the most popular for dental support services students pursuing a associate degree. When you put them all together, these colleges and universities awarded 264 associate degrees in dental support services during the 2019-2020 academic year.
